Cattle selection and purchase:
Bullocks are suitable for fattening. For this purpose, it is better to purchase a bull calf of 1.5 to 2 years of age.
Housing:House should be built on a land of 1.5m x 2 m dimension for eachcattle.

Feed (ration) formulation for fattening:
Feed that are mixed with urea and molasses are helpful for fattening. These items canbe supplied in two ways 1) By mixing with straw and 2) By mixing with concentrate.
Preparation of cattle feed by mixing urea with straw:
1. Firstly, a dol (large type basket) is taken and plastered with mud then dried.
2. 20 liters of water is taken in a bucket3. 1 kg of urea is mixed with that water4. Small amount of straw is kept in the dol and then urea
solution is sprayed over it. Pressing is done while adding straw5. Dol is fulfilled with straw in this way.6. Dol is covered with polythene after filling it and kept it tied.7. After 10-12 days straw will be taken out of the dol and will
be kept outside for sun drying.8. After sun drying straw will be suitable for feeding.9. Generally cattle should be supplied with straw that is mixed
with 3 kg of urea.10. Each day, 300-400 gm of molasses should be mixed with
straw.
